Rangers news: McAvennie suggests the real reason Todd Cantwell started Celtic bust-up

Rangers ace Todd Cantwell was “stupid” for instigating a post-match bust-up with Celtic defender Callum McGregor after the Old Firm.

Speaking exclusively to Football Insider, former Hoops and West Ham striker Frank McAvennie slaughtered Cantwell, 26, and claimed he only shoved McGregor, 30, to “play to the cameras”.

Sky Sports footage showed the Englishman confronting McGregor after the full-time whistle before Leon Balogun pulled him out of the escalating bust-up.

Cantwell was dropped to the bench by Philippe Clement for the all-important Ibrox showdown, which ended 3-3, but was brought on in the 69th minute.

Todd Cantwell thinks he’s a ‘hard man’, but he is not – McAvennie

McAvennie admitted that there is a “good player” in Cantwell, but was far from impressed with his full-time antics.

“It was Cantwell again,” he told Football Insider.

“From what I know, he’s not getting a game at the moment so he’s taking it out on somebody else.

“It was Greg Taylor and Callum McGregor he shoved.

“He’s playing to the crowd and the cameras because he can’t do anything else!

“He did something similar with Reo Hatate [in the Scottish Cup semi-final last season] when he didn’t let him have any water.

“There’s a good player in there but it was a bit stupid, he does stupid things.

“He tries to play the hard man, but he’s not a hard man.

“I can understand that he’s upset because he’s not getting minutes, but come on.”
